Taxonomic Classification

Rank Chinese river dolphin Plain-flanked Rail
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Aves (Birds)
Order Cetacea (Whales & Dolphins) Gruiformes (Gruiformes)
Family Lipotidae Rallidae
Genus Lipotes Rallus
Species Lipotes vexillifer Rallus wetmorei

Evolutionary Relationship

Chinese river dolphin and Plain-flanked Rail share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
